Transaction 68113b4e77398e34f6197d9a1d4cac0edaf0068a1adc3bc356eb73a56e0295a5
1 Input
1 Output
-
68113b4e77398e34f6197d9a1d4cac0edaf0068a1adc3bc356eb73a56e0295a5:0
- value
- 3004566
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4cf75ed8de3afb8bb0076e001412644bae1c92e6 OP_EQUAL
- address
- 38hycj5VqmA2GaehnGGk7aK87Et9oB1msu